House raising services involve elevating a residential structure to a higher level on its foundation. This process typically includes carefully lifting the entire building using specialized equipment, then placing it on a new or reinforced foundation. The goal is to protect the property from flood damage, manage water runoff, or prepare the site for foundation repairs or renovations. House raising is a complex project that requires precise planning and execution to ensure the stability and safety of the structure during and after the elevation process.

This service helps address common problems associated with flood-prone areas or properties situated in low-lying regions. Homes that have experienced water intrusion, foundation issues, or are located in areas with changing water levels often benefit from house raising. By elevating the structure, homeowners can reduce the risk of flood damage, minimize water-related repairs, and improve the overall resilience of their property. Additionally, house raising can facilitate foundation repairs or upgrades that might otherwise be difficult to perform without lifting the building.

Properties that typically utilize house raising services include older homes in flood zones, coastal residences, and properties with deteriorating foundations. These structures often face challenges related to water damage, structural instability, or zoning regulations that require elevation for compliance. Additionally, some homeowners choose to raise their homes to create additional usable space underneath or to meet local floodplain management requirements. The process is adaptable to a variety of residential types, including single-family homes, cottages, and small multi-unit buildings.

Cost Range for House Raising - The typical cost for raising a house varies widely based on size and foundation type, generally falling between $30,000 and $100,000. Smaller homes may be on the lower end, while larger or more complex projects tend to cost more. Local pros can provide detailed estimates based on specific needs.

Factors Influencing Costs - Expenses depend on house size, foundation condition, and the extent of structural work needed. For example, raising a small bungalow might cost around $30,000, whereas a larger, multi-story home could exceed $100,000. Additional services like foundation repair or custom modifications can increase costs.

Regional Price Variations - Costs for house raising services can vary by location, with prices in Fenton, MI, typically aligning with nearby areas. Local factors such as labor rates and material costs influence overall pricing. Contacting local contractors can help obtain accurate, site-specific estimates.

Additional Cost Considerations - Permits, inspections, and site preparation are often extra expenses that impact the overall cost. These additional costs can add several thousand dollars to the project, depending on local regulations and property conditions. Pros can assist in providing comprehensive cost assessments.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
